On a cold day, a metal measuring tape marked in millimetres is used to find the separation between two fence posts. The reading on the tape is $3.000\,\text{m}$. On a much hotter day, the same metal measuring tape is then used again to measure the length of that same distance. The metal measuring tape is at a higher temperature than the ground, while the ground temperature stays unchanged. Which statement is correct?
- AThe measuring tape reads less than $3.000\,\text{m}$ because the graduations are closer together.
- BThe measuring tape reads less than $3.000\,\text{m}$ because the graduations are further apart.
- CThe measuring tape reads more than $3.000\,\text{m}$ because the graduations are closer together.
- DThe measuring tape reads more than $3.000\,\text{m}$ because the graduations are further apart.
